Tommy Melo is the president of Biosfera, an environmental organization in Cabo Verde, who has recently been vocal about the potential environmental risks posed by the sinking of the cargo ship Nhô Padre Benjamim, emphasizing the need to assess and mitigate pollution from hydrocarbons still aboard the vessel.
